Inje University Sanggye Paik Hospital (인제대학교 상계백병원) is a private general hospital (종합병원, not tertiary/상급종합병원) in Sanggye-dong, Nowon-gu, Seoul, opened 1989-08-15 (groundbreaking 1988-01-18) with 450 beds as one of the Paik hospitals run by Inje University's Baik Medical Center network. It now operates 513 KOIHA-licensed beds (per the current government registry, superseding the 1989 opening figure), holds current KOIHA acute-care hospital accreditation (2023-2027), and runs named centers for liver/organ/stem-cell transplant, Gamma Knife radiosurgery, robotic surgery, cancer (with gastric, colorectal and breast sub-centers), cardiovascular and cerebrovascular disease, severe trauma, bloodless medicine, spine surgery and digestive disease, alongside an international healthcare center and a comprehensive health-promotion (checkup) center.

Private · Inje University (인제대학교) — one of the Paik hospitals (백병원) run by the Inje University Baik Medical Center network (인제학원 백중앙의료원), founded by Dr. Paik In-je (백인제). Sister campuses: Busan Paik (Busanjin-gu), Haeundae Paik (Haeundae-gu, Busan — a DIFFERENT, separately-sourced campus from this Nowon-gu one), Ilsan Paik (Goyang); Seoul Paik Hospital (부속 서울백병원) closed 2023-08-31.

South Korea crossed the 1-million mark as a medical-travel destination for the first time in 2024: about 1.17 million foreign patients were treated, up 93.2% from 610,000 in 2023 (Ministry of Health and Welfare / KHIDI). The largest patient groups came from Japan, China, the United States, Thailand and Taiwan, and the most-used specialties were dermatology, plastic surgery, internal/general medicine and health screening. Seoul concentrates most volume, drawing patients for aesthetic and dermatologic care, health check-ups, oncology and advanced surgery delivered in JCI-accredited hospitals with dedicated international-patient centers — at prices below the US while the government regulates and publishes standards through KHIDI's Medical Korea program.

Visa
Most Western nationalities (US, UK, EU/Schengen, Australia, Canada, New Zealand, Japan) enter visa-free for short medical or tourist visits. The K-ETA (electronic travel authorization) requirement is temporarily WAIVED for 67 countries and territories through 31 December 2026 — eligible travellers enter without applying for a K-ETA; the requirement is expected to resume 1 January 2027. Confirm your nationality's current rule before travelling.
Medical / long-stay visa
For treatment, foreign patients typically use the C-3-3 medical tourism visa (short-term, stays up to 90 days, generally not extendable beyond 90 days except in special circumstances). For treatment or recovery longer than 90 days, patients change to or apply for the G-1-10 long-term medical treatment visa, which can be extended inside Korea; it requires hospital documentation (medical opinion, treatment schedule, payment records). Applications must be tied to a medical institution registered with KTO/KHIDI.
Arrival
From 1 January 2026, all foreign arrivals must file the mandatory digital e-Arrival Card online (within 3 days before arrival) — it replaces the paper disembarkation card and is a declaration, not a visa. Travellers who hold an approved K-ETA are exempt from the arrival card, but nationals of K-ETA-waived countries (US, UK, EU, Japan, etc.) must still complete the e-Arrival Card.
